-- +---------------------------+
-- |   Copyright 1996 DOULOS   |
-- |      Generic Library      |
-- |    opened: 29 Nov 1995    |
-- +---------------------------+

-- Function: conversion function matrix for types "integer",
--           "std_ulogic_vector", and "twos_complement".           

library ieee;
library vfp;

package generic_conversions is
  use ieee.std_logic_1164.all;
  use vfp.twos_complement_types.all;

function to_integer (
  a: std_ulogic_vector
) return integer; -- 29.11.95  

function to_integer (a: std_logic_vector) return integer; -- 03.02.95  
function to_integer (a: twos_complement) return integer;   -- 29.11.95

--function to_std_logic (a: integer) return std_logic;                -- 29.11.95

function to_std_ulogic_vector (a: integer) return std_ulogic_vector;                -- 29.11.95
function to_std_ulogic_vector (a: twos_complement) return std_ulogic_vector; -- 29.11.95
-- see std_logic_1164	for std_logic_vector -> std_ulogic_vector conv/n func/n
function to_std_ulogic_vector (a: integer; width: integer) return std_ulogic_vector;                -- 29.11.95

function to_std_logic_vector (a: integer) return std_logic_vector;                -- 05.07.95

function to_twos_complement (a: integer) return twos_complement;           -- 29.11.95
function to_twos_complement (a: std_ulogic_vector) return twos_complement; -- 29.11.95

end generic_conversions;






<div align="center"><br /><script type="text/javascript"><!--
google_ad_client = "pub-7293844627074885";
//468x60, Created at 07. 11. 25
google_ad_slot = "8619794253";
google_ad_width = 468;
google_ad_height = 60;
//--></script>
<script type="text/javascript" src="http://pagead2.googlesyndication.com/pagead/show_ads.js">
</script><br />&nbsp;</div>